The thing I love about this project is not only this cute little bunny, but also the little basket he rests in. This Berry Basket is cut from a Bigz Die available in the Occasions Catalog and is super, super easy!
I will tell you, that when you cut this basket out, it is recommended to use the Premium Crease Pad. I followed this instruction and some of the cuts didn't go all the way through. So I set the Crease Pad aside and used the clear cutting mats and it cut perfectly. ALL MACHINES CUT A LITTLE DIFFERENTLY, SO IF ONE WAY DOESN'T WORK, TRY ANOTHER.

I used the large cellophane bags (6" X 8") for the candy and his bow is made from the Crushed Curry Chevron Ribbon, cut to 11".
